Output d75d26817629e18d4f3e4065836bd6ab2c1813797f5f64cd4c83ee93f0e2a8bc:9

value
10522300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8858ca61f8e45adbbd015aa7f1f8af48c55b7f6a OP_EQUALVERIFY OP_CHECKSIG
address
1DRwGNAwGpW7foj5owXDikF4AUdYzQtesS
transaction
d75d26817629e18d4f3e4065836bd6ab2c1813797f5f64cd4c83ee93f0e2a8bc
spent
true